    TITLE 16 - CONSERVATION
    CHAPTER 1 - NATIONAL PARKS, MILITARY PARKS, MONUMENTS, AND SEASHORES
    SUBCHAPTER LXVIII - NATIONAL CONSERVATION RECREATIONAL AREAS

HEAD

    Sec. 460k-1. Acquisition of lands for recreational development;
      funds

STATUTE

      The Secretary is authorized to acquire areas of land, or
    interests therein, which are suitable for -
        (1) incidental fish and wildlife-oriented recreational
      development,
        (2) the protection of natural resources,
        (3) the conservation of endangered species or threatened
      species listed by the Secretary pursuant to section 1533 of this
      title, or
        (4) carrying out two or more of the purposes set forth in
      paragraphs (1) through (3) of this section, and are adjacent to,
      or within, the said conservation areas, except that the
      acquisition of any land or interest therein pursuant to this
      section shall be accomplished only with such funds as may be
      appropriated therefor by the Congress or donated for such
      purposes, but such property shall not be acquired with funds
      obtained from the sale of Federal migratory bird hunting stamps.
    Lands acquired pursuant to this section shall become a part of the
    particular conservation area to which they are adjacent.

SOURCE

    (Pub. L. 87-714, Sec. 2, Sept. 28, 1962, 76 Stat. 653; Pub. L. 92-
    534, Oct. 23, 1972, 86 Stat. 1063; Pub. L. 93-205, Sec. 13(d),
    Dec. 28, 1973, 87 Stat. 902.)

AMENDMENTS

      1973 - Pub. L. 93-205 inserted references to the acquisition of
    interest in land the conservation of endangered species or
    threatened species listed by the Secretary pursuant to section 1533
    of this title.
      1972 - Pub. L. 92-534 substituted provisions authorizing the
    Secretary to acquire lands suitable for fish and wildlife oriented
    recreational development, or for the protection of natural
    resources and adjacent to conservation areas, for provisions
    authorizing the Secretary to acquire limited areas of land for
    recreational development adjacent to conservation areas in
    existence or approved by the Migratory Bird Conservation Commission
    as of September 28, 1962.
                     EFFECTIVE DATE OF 1973 AMENDMENT
      Amendment by Pub. L. 93-205 effective Dec. 28, 1973, see section
    16 of Pub. L. 93-205, set out as a note under section 1531 of this
    title.
